Tamannaah Bhatia’s trajectory is a mirror to the evolution of Telugu cinema itself. She began as the perfect manifestation of the industry’s old expectations—a glamorous, dancer, romantic lead. Through strategic choices and a landmark role in Baahubali , she transcended those boundaries. Finally, by embracing the digital medium and author-backed roles, she has redrawn the map for what a "Telugu heroine" can be. Her career demonstrates that entertainment content in popular media is not static; it evolves with audience taste, technology, and the ambitions of its artists. Tamannaah’s enduring success lies in her chameleonic ability to be both the beloved muddu (cute) girl of 100% Love and the fierce warrior Avanthika, and now, the nuanced performer of the OTT space. In doing so, she has not just survived the shifting tides of Tollywood; she has helped steer the ship, proving that for the modern heroine, the only constant is transformative reinvention.
The defining turning point of Tamannaah’s association with Telugu cinema came with S.S. Rajamouli’s epic Baahubali: The Beginning (2015). As Avanthika, a fierce warrior member of a rebel group, Tamannaah shattered the stereotype of the passive commercial heroine. The role demanded intense physical training, sword-fighting skills, and a calculated balance of rugged determination and ethereal grace.
